V²raz typu Boolean
V²raz typu Boolean je specißlnφm p°φpadem v²razu. Pou₧φvß se vÜude tak, kde dle syntaxe vnit°nφho programovacφho jazyka mß b²t podmφnka, tedy nap°.:
- v p°φkazech REPEAT - UNTIL, WHILE - DO, IF- THEN;
- jako podmφnka viditelnosti nebo podmφnka aktivity slo₧ky pohledu, jako integritnφ omezenφ ve formulß°i , dßle p°i definovßnφ polo₧ek menu.
Hodnota v²razu musφ b²t typu Boolean. Takovouto hodnotu majφ:
- konstanty FALSE a TRUE;
- vÜechny prom∞nnΘ a sloupce typu Boolean;
- v²sledky operacφ OR, AND a NOT;
- v²sledky relacφ <, <=, >, >=, =, <>, .=, .=., ~;
- hodnoty funkcφ typu Boolean, a¥ u₧ definovan²ch u₧ivatelem nebo standardnφch (nap°. funkce
Odd
).
V²raz typu Boolean se vyhodnocuje dle vÜeobecn∞ platn²ch priorit operßtor∙. Vzhledem k tomu, ₧e operace AND a OR majφ vyÜÜφ prioritu ne₧ relace rovnosti a nerovnosti, nelze ve v²razech jako:
(A < 5) and (B >= 17)
vynechat ₧ßdnΘ zßvorky!
Viz takΘ:
Programy
Vnit°nφ programovacφ jazyk